Two outlets report a dispute in Spain involving a woman who allegedly left a bar without paying her bill, then disappeared for several years. According to the reports, after the unpaid bill incident, the woman does not return for around three years. When she eventually comes back to the venue, the bar owner reportedly confronts her about the outstanding payment. The accounts describe an exchange between the two at the bar that escalates into a public disagreement. The woman is then said to respond with a harsh online review, portraying the confrontation negatively.
The reports frame the incident as a viral online argument, with the details centered on accusations and the public posting of complaints rather than any immediate legal outcome. Both sources agree on the core timeline: an alleged non-payment by a customer, a period of absence, a later confrontation by the owner, and the dispute being reflected online through reviews. The reporting does not confirm the final resolution of any legal or formal process.
